Remembering the Unique Look and Feel - Twin Peaks Filming Locations
A big part of what made Twin Peaks so visually striking was its setting. The show was, in a way, deeply connected to the natural surroundings where it was filmed, primarily in Washington state. The tall, dark trees, the misty air, and the specific architecture of the small towns used for filming all contributed to the program's unique atmosphere. It wasn't just a backdrop; it was almost like another character in the story, adding to the feeling of mystery and, you know, a certain kind of beauty. The locations helped to create that particular look and feel that fans instantly recognize. When you think about the Double R Diner, or the sheriff's department, or even the woods surrounding the town, those places are ingrained in the collective memory of the show.
